核心内容摘要
步骤里程碑式最新安卓版
蜘蛛池定制技术:构建高效网络爬虫,助力数据采集与智能分析
在当今信息爆炸的时代,数据采集和智能分析成为了企业获取竞争优势的关键。网络爬虫作为数据采集的重要工具,其效率和准确性直接影响到数据分析的结果。本文将详细解析蜘蛛池定制技术,探讨如何构建高效的网络爬虫,以助力数据采集与智能分析。
蜘蛛池技术概述
蜘蛛池技术是一种网络爬虫管理技术,它通过集中管理多个爬虫实例,实现对大规模网页数据的高效采集。这种技术的核心在于动态分配任务给不同的爬虫,以优化资源利用和提高采集效率。
定制化网络爬虫的重要性
在不同的应用场景中,数据采集的需求千差万别。定制化的网络爬虫能够根据特定需求,针对性地设计爬取策略和数据处理流程,从而提高数据采集的准确性和效率。
1. 针对性的数据采集
定制化的网络爬虫可以根据目标网站的特点,设计特定的爬取规则,避免无效数据的采集,提高数据的相关性和价值。
2. 灵活的爬取策略
面对不同的网站结构和反爬虫机制,定制化的网络爬虫可以灵活调整爬取策略,如调整爬取速度、使用代理IP等,以适应不同的采集环境。
3. 高效的数据处理
定制化的网络爬虫可以在数据采集的同时进行初步处理,如去重、格式化等,减少后续数据处理的工作量,提高整体效率。
构建高效网络爬虫的步骤
构建一个高效的网络爬虫需要经过以下几个步骤:
1. 明确目标和需求
在开始构建网络爬虫之前,首先要明确数据采集的目标和需求,包括需要采集的数据类型、数据量、数据更新频率等。
2. 设计爬取策略
根据目标网站的特点和需求,设计合适的爬取策略。这可能包括选择合适的爬取速度、使用代理IP、模拟浏览器行为等。
3. 开发爬虫程序
使用合适的编程语言和工具,如Python、Scrapy等,开发网络爬虫程序。在开发过程中,要注重代码的可读性和可维护性。
4. 测试和优化
在开发完成后,对网络爬虫进行测试,检查其稳定性和效率。根据测试结果,对爬虫进行优化,以提高其性能。
5. 部署和监控
将网络爬虫部署到服务器上,并设置监控机制,以确保其稳定运行。同时,根据实际情况调整爬取策略,以适应网站的变化。
蜘蛛池技术的应用案例
蜘蛛池技术在多个领域都有广泛的应用,以下是一些典型的应用案例:
1. 电子商务数据采集
在电子商务领域,通过蜘蛛池技术可以高效地采集商品信息、价格、评价等数据,为市场分析和竞争情报提供支持。
2. 社交媒体监控
在社交媒体监控中,蜘蛛池技术可以帮助企业实时监控品牌声誉、用户反馈等信息,及时响应市场变化。
3. 金融数据采集
在金融领域,蜘蛛池技术可以用于采集股票、外汇等金融市场数据,为投资决策提供数据支持。
结论
蜘蛛池定制技术是构建高效网络爬虫的关键,它能够根据特定需求设计爬取策略,提高数据采集的效率和准确性。通过明确目标、设计策略、开发程序、测试优化和部署监控,可以构建出适合特定场景的高效网络爬虫,为数据采集与智能分析提供强有力的支持。随着技术的不断发展,蜘蛛池技术将在更多领域发挥其重要作用。
优化核心要点
江西赣州的天气预报-江西赣州的天气预报2026最新版v.13.04.48 最新安卓版-1865安卓网